About NEET

The National Eligibility cum Entrance Test or NEET-UG is a medical entrance examination in India for admission to MBBS & BDS courses in government and private medical and dental colleges run with the approval of Medical Council of India/Dental Council of India under the Union Ministry of Health and Family Welfare, Government of India. .

NEET-UG, for MBBS and BDS courses will be conducted by the Central Board of Secondary Education (CBSE). In 2016, AIPMT was replaced by NEET-UG. The exam was conducted in two phases – NEET Phase 1 (May 1) and NEET Phase II (July 24).

It is to be noted that Undergraduate courses at AIIMS in New Delhi, Postgraduate Institute for Medical Education and Research in Chandigarh, JIPMER are beyond NEET’s ambit.

In July 2016, NEET got legal status. Lok Sabha passed a bill making NEET a single and common entrance exam for admission to medical and dental courses in India. The new law is applicable for both private and government colleges. The bill received approval from Rajya Sabha too.
